Output 776839ba1abd8a54e50d566c0ff26a6b7e035e4c919dd88f61ee85019ef043d3:3

value
949650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ba20e0c40e3149edd5d90d01a4bf0494b41eed4 OP_EQUAL
address
3LFjEFmS86QbTboYCX8M5vK1w2byahfqXL
transaction
776839ba1abd8a54e50d566c0ff26a6b7e035e4c919dd88f61ee85019ef043d3
spent
true